ETHAN BENNETT ZUK BOYER
February 1, 2000 - October 25, 2019
Ethan was born in Winnipeg on Tuesday, February 1, 2000. He grew up in the Balmoral area where he attended Balmoral School from K-8. During his time at Balmoral School he made many lifelong friends including best friends, Arron Loewen and Erin Waterer. Ethan then attended Stonewall Collegiate where he graduated in 2018. In his last year at school he went on a school trip to Greece which he loved.
Ethan's life revolved around hockey from age five and onward. He played on various hockey teams where he made many, many friends. Besides Stonewall club teams, Ethan played on Interlake Lighting Bantam and was a proud player for three years on SCI Rams. After graduation, his passion for hockey continued, with him lastly playing on three different hockey teams. Ethan would pack his gear and keep it in his car in hopes he was called in to spare on another team.
This summer, Ethan was given the opportunity to work at City of Winnipeg Pools and Maintenance Department which he enjoyed and made many new work friends. He was looking forward to returning in 2020. This new job allowed him to purchase his first motorcycle (CBR600) so he could join his buddies riding. Ethan was currently enrolled in computer science at the U of M. He had a special skill set for making gaming computers and excelled in online gaming where he made many virtual friends who will also miss him dearly.
Ethan was a kind and gentle giant with a unique sense of humour and an endless love for animals. He enjoyed all sports, loved life and had a passion for snowmobiling and motorbikes.
Loved ones that have cleared the path to heaven for Ethan are his Grandpa Albert Boyer, Nana Barbara and Papa Jan Zuk.
Loved ones who will miss Ethan until they meet again are Grandma Muriel Boyer, Nana Jean Zuk; aunts and uncles, Richard and Sandra Zuk, Barb and Ron Nordal, Jack and Carol Boyer, Jeanette and Barry Sheasgreen; cousins, Alaina (John), Ashlee (Patrick), Leanne (Aaron), Scott, Garrett (Katarina) and Lana (Cory); also missing him are cats, Callie and Titan; puppy dogs, Hunter, Ecko, and Ethan's dog Thanos.
A special thank you to those who stopped to help and pray for Ethan at the scene. Our family would also like to thank the RM of Macdonald Fire Department, W.F.P.S., STARS, W.P.S., R.C.M.P. especially Cst. S. Fenton for her ongoing support.
A celebration of Ethan's life will be held on Friday, November 15 at 1:00 p.m. at New Life Church, Stonewall with reception to follow. There will be a private family interment later in the new year.
Those attending the service are invited to bring a "Tin for the Critter Bin" in support of local animal shelters. In celebration of Ethan's love of hockey, attendees are welcome to wear a hockey jersey.
